The Nutricook Steami X 24L stands out as a true marvel of modern kitchen technology, blending the functionalities of a steam oven, an air fryer, and a convection oven into a single, sleek appliance. Its 10-in-1 functions, including Steam Cook, Steam Roast, Air Fry, Bake, and Sterilize, make it an incredibly versatile companion for any Indian kitchen. The powerful 2200W heating element ensures rapid preheating and efficient cooking, while the innovative Steam + Convection technology promises dishes that are crispy on the outside and moist on the inside, revolutionizing healthy cooking at home. This is an ideal choice for those looking to embrace a healthier lifestyle without compromising on taste or variety.
While the Nutricook Steami X offers unparalleled versatility, its 24L capacity might be a limiting factor for larger Indian families who frequently cook for gatherings. Furthermore, being at the upper end of our ₹20,000 budget, it represents a significant investment compared to standard convection microwaves. Some users might also find the extensive range of functions initially overwhelming, requiring a slight learning curve to fully utilize its potential. It's a premium offering that delivers on its promises, but discerning buyers should weigh their capacity needs and willingness to explore advanced cooking methods.
This oven is perfectly suited for health-conscious individuals, small to medium-sized families (2-4 members), and culinary enthusiasts eager to experiment with diverse cooking techniques like steaming and air frying. If you prioritize nutrient retention, reduced oil consumption, and the convenience of having multiple appliances rolled into one, the Nutricook Steami X 24L is an exceptional choice. Its ability to sterilize also adds value for families with infants or those who prioritize hygiene, making it a forward-thinking addition to a smart home.

The Samsung 28 L Convection Microwave Oven (MC28A5145VK/TL) is a robust and intelligently designed appliance that offers exceptional value, especially considering its brand reputation and feature set. With a generous 28-litre capacity, it's well-suited for medium to large Indian families. What truly sets this model apart is its innovative Moisture Sensor, which automatically adjusts cooking time to prevent over or under-cooking, ensuring perfectly delicious results every time. The inclusion of 'SlimFry' technology allows users to prepare crispy, fried foods with significantly less oil, appealing to health-conscious individuals seeking a healthier alternative to deep frying, making it a fantastic all-rounder for daily use.
While the Samsung MC28A5145VK/TL excels in convection microwave functions and offers a healthy SlimFry option, it doesn't feature dedicated steam cooking or full-fledged air frying capabilities like some of the more specialized ovens. Users primarily looking for specific steam functions for delicate dishes or the intense crispness of a dedicated air fryer might find it slightly limited in those specific areas. Additionally, while the SlimFry is impressive, it shouldn't be confused with the performance of a standalone air fryer for certain demanding applications.
This Samsung convection microwave is an excellent choice for families seeking a reliable, multi-functional oven primarily for baking, grilling, reheating, and preparing everyday meals with a healthier twist. Its intuitive controls, sturdy build, and the brand's extensive service network in India make it a dependable workhorse for kitchens where a balanced mix of traditional microwave, convection, and healthy frying functions are paramount. If you prioritize convenience, consistent results, and a trusted brand at an attractive price point, this model is hard to beat.

The LG 28 L Convection Microwave Oven (MC2846BV) has earned its stellar reputation, reflected in its thousands of positive reviews, by perfectly catering to the unique demands of Indian cooking. Its standout features include a dedicated 'Health Plus Menu' and specialized 'Indian Cuisine' auto-cook options, including the beloved 'Tandoor Se' function, allowing users to effortlessly prepare authentic Indian dishes like tandoori rotis and kebabs at home. The stainless steel cavity ensures uniform heating and durability, while the convenient 'Steam Clean' feature simplifies maintenance, making it a highly practical and user-friendly appliance for busy households.
While the LG MC2846BV is exceptionally good at what it does, particularly for Indian cuisine, it is primarily a convection microwave and doesn't offer the advanced steam cooking or powerful air frying capabilities seen in some newer, more specialized models. Its focus remains on traditional baking, grilling, reheating, and specific Indian recipes. For users looking for a multi-functional appliance that can also steam delicate vegetables or air fry a large batch of pakoras to perfection with minimal oil, this oven might require supplementing with other specialized gadgets.
This LG oven is an absolute winner for Indian families who frequently cook traditional meals and value convenience and authentic results. Its extensive auto-cook menus for Indian dishes, coupled with features like Health Plus and Tandoor Se, make it an indispensable tool for preparing everything from naan to curries. The large capacity and easy cleaning further solidify its position as a top recommendation for those seeking a reliable, high-performance convection microwave that truly understands the Indian palate.

The AGARO Galaxy Digital Air Fryer presents an incredibly compelling option for those primarily seeking the benefits of air frying without the bulk or cost of a full-sized convection microwave. At a remarkably affordable price point of ₹4,499, it delivers a dedicated air frying experience with a powerful 1400W heating element and 360-degree air circulation for even, crispy results. Its compact 4.5L capacity is perfect for individuals or small families, and the 7 preset programs, along with a digital touch display, make it exceptionally easy to use for everyday tasks like baking small items, roasting vegetables, toasting bread, and reheating.
However, the AGARO Galaxy's primary limitation is its specialized nature and relatively small capacity. At 4.5L, it’s not designed for cooking large meals or baking full-sized cakes and pizzas, making it unsuitable as a primary oven for a family of four or more. While it can bake, roast, and toast, its functionality is much more restricted compared to a full convection microwave oven. It also lacks advanced features like steam cooking or a rotisserie, making it less versatile for diverse culinary experiments beyond healthier frying and quick snacks.
This air fryer is an ideal purchase for bachelors, couples, or small families who are specifically looking to incorporate healthier, oil-free frying into their diet. It's also an excellent secondary appliance for homes that already have a traditional oven but want a quick, energy-efficient solution for snacks, appetizers, or small batches of roasted vegetables. For budget-conscious buyers who prioritize healthy frying and compact design, the AGARO Galaxy offers outstanding value and performance within its niche.

The IFB 30L Convection Microwave Oven (30BRC2) is a powerhouse designed for families who demand both capacity and versatility from their kitchen appliances. Its massive 30-litre interior can easily accommodate larger dishes, making it perfect for cooking for big Indian families or entertaining guests. What truly sets this IFB model apart is its astounding 101 standard cook menus, simplifying a vast array of dishes, from exotic cuisines to everyday staples. The inclusion of a 360-degree motorized rotisserie is a game-changer for non-vegetarian households, enabling perfectly grilled chickens and kebabs, while features like 'Weight Defrost' and 'Steam Clean' add layers of convenience and easy maintenance.
While the IFB 30BRC2 offers an incredible range of auto-cook menus and a fantastic rotisserie, it primarily functions as a high-end convection microwave. It does not integrate specialized steam cooking or dedicated air frying capabilities, which are becoming popular in newer, premium models. For users who prioritize healthy oil-free frying above all else, or wish to explore delicate steam recipes, this oven might require a separate air fryer or steamer. Furthermore, while 101 menus are impressive, some users might find many of them repetitive or simply stick to a handful of their favorites, potentially underutilizing its full potential.
This IFB convection microwave is ideally suited for large Indian families, avid home bakers, and those who frequently prepare grilled dishes, especially non-vegetarian items, thanks to the motorized rotisserie. If you appreciate having a vast library of pre-set cooking options to experiment with, value a robust appliance from a trusted Indian brand, and need a generous capacity for your culinary adventures, the 30BRC2 is an excellent investment. It promises to be a central and highly capable appliance in a busy kitchen.

Q1: What is the main difference between a Convection Microwave Oven and an OTG (Oven Toaster Griller)? A1: A Convection Microwave Oven combines microwave functions (reheating, defrosting) with convection (baking, grilling). An OTG, on the other hand, is a dedicated appliance solely for baking, grilling, and toasting, using heating coils. OTGs typically offer more precise temperature control for baking, while convection microwaves provide speed and versatility.
Q2: Can I use metal utensils in a convection microwave oven? A2: You can use metal utensils, bakeware, and grill racks when using the convection or grill functions of your oven. However, NEVER use metal in the microwave mode, as it can cause sparks and damage the appliance. Always check the manufacturer's instructions for specific guidelines.
Q3: What are the benefits of an oven with a 'Steam Clean' function? A3: A 'Steam Clean' function uses steam to loosen food splatters and grease inside the oven cavity, making it much easier to wipe clean. This reduces the need for harsh chemical cleaners and extensive scrubbing, simplifying maintenance and promoting better hygiene.
Q4: Is an Air Fryer oven the same as a Convection Microwave with an air fry mode? A4: Not entirely. A dedicated air fryer oven (like the AGARO) is specifically designed for rapid air circulation, often achieving crispier results with less oil. While many convection microwaves now include an 'Air Fry' or 'SlimFry' mode (e.g., Samsung), these typically use a combination of convection and grill elements to simulate air frying, and may not deliver the exact same intensity or speed as a specialized air fryer.
Q5: How important is the cavity material (e.g., Stainless Steel) in an oven? A5: The cavity material plays a role in durability, ease of cleaning, and cooking efficiency. Stainless steel cavities (e.g., LG) are highly durable, rust-resistant, and reflect heat well for even cooking. They are also generally easier to clean compared to painted cavities. Ceramic enamel is another good option, offering scratch resistance and antibacterial properties.
